Confusion with Excel + Forms

I have already created a Forms sheet with some questions for new users to fill in, and I know these are stored in an Excel sheet... But why can't I link said Forms to an Excel Online sheet? The only option I can find regarding an Excel is to download it, but I'd like my colleagues to see the responses to the form as well.

Is there any way to link that Form to an Excel in a sharepoint or a shared folder?

